summaryrefslogtreecommitdiffstats
path: root/media/libmedia/IAudioFlingerClient.cpp
diff options
context:
space:
mode:
authorThe Android Open Source Project <initial-contribution@android.com>2009-02-13 12:57:50 -0800
committerThe Android Open Source Project <initial-contribution@android.com>2009-02-13 12:57:50 -0800
commitda996f390e17e16f2dfa60e972e7ebc4f868f37e (patch)
tree00a0f15270d4c7b619fd34d8383257e1761082f4 /media/libmedia/IAudioFlingerClient.cpp
parentd24b8183b93e781080b2c16c487e60d51c12da31 (diff)
downloadframeworks_base-da996f390e17e16f2dfa60e972e7ebc4f868f37e.zip
frameworks_base-da996f390e17e16f2dfa60e972e7ebc4f868f37e.tar.gz
frameworks_base-da996f390e17e16f2dfa60e972e7ebc4f868f37e.tar.bz2
auto import from //branches/cupcake/...@131421
Diffstat (limited to 'media/libmedia/IAudioFlingerClient.cpp')
-rw-r--r--media/libmedia/IAudioFlingerClient.cpp12
1 files changed, 4 insertions, 8 deletions
diff --git a/media/libmedia/IAudioFlingerClient.cpp b/media/libmedia/IAudioFlingerClient.cpp
index d956266..5feb11f 100644
--- a/media/libmedia/IAudioFlingerClient.cpp
+++ b/media/libmedia/IAudioFlingerClient.cpp
@@ -38,13 +38,11 @@ public:
{
}
- void audioOutputChanged(uint32_t frameCount, uint32_t samplingRate, uint32_t latency)
+ void a2dpEnabledChanged(bool enabled)
{
Parcel data, reply;
data.writeInterfaceToken(IAudioFlingerClient::getInterfaceDescriptor());
- data.writeInt32(frameCount);
- data.writeInt32(samplingRate);
- data.writeInt32(latency);
+ data.writeInt32((int)enabled);
remote()->transact(AUDIO_OUTPUT_CHANGED, data, &reply);
}
};
@@ -65,10 +63,8 @@ status_t BnAudioFlingerClient::onTransact(
switch(code) {
case AUDIO_OUTPUT_CHANGED: {
CHECK_INTERFACE(IAudioFlingerClient, data, reply);
- uint32_t frameCount = data.readInt32();
- uint32_t samplingRate = data.readInt32();
- uint32_t latency = data.readInt32();
- audioOutputChanged(frameCount, samplingRate, latency);
+ bool enabled = (bool)data.readInt32();
+ a2dpEnabledChanged(enabled);
return NO_ERROR;
} break;
default: